    What a great little find on a Monday afternoon! We didn't know it was the oldest bar in Naugatuck (over 100 years old) and it was fun learning the history. The people there, both the staff AND the customers, were super friendly. It felt like a small hometown bar/restaurant. While the steak sandwiches looked amazing, we always lean towards WINGS! And wings we got. Six flavors including buffalo, buffalo bleu, teriyaki, sweet heat, mango habanero, and cajun dry rub. They were excellent. The smaller variety and cooked a little well done (as requested). It's definitely worth a visit to check out this piece of Naugatuck history! Wings up!
